You can download The Missing: Island of Lost Ships here. Escape from a mysterious island in The Missing: Island of Lost Ships! Your friend Robert was on the trail of an ancient artifact when he vanished at sea several days ago. You set out to search for him only to find yourself trapped on the mysterious Island of Lost Ships! Now you must save both Robert and yourself from the villainous Sea Dogs and their ruthless leader, the Admiral. Use your skills to uncover the secrets of the island and find your way home in this thrilling hidden-object adventure! I quit this game at about 3/4 of the way, too many HOs. It seemed the further you get into the game the more HOs would pop up one after another, quite disappointing since the first game was so much more interesting and with less HOs and the first game had a more gripping story that kept you into the storyline. Oh well, as some Mods and experienced gamers have said: They try to make games to please everybody, so those of you who were disappointed with the lack of HOs in the 1st one and hesitated to buy the 2nd one, should reconsider, me thinks you will be happy with the number of HOs in this one.
